THAILAND
Thailand, formerly known as Siam and officially called the Kingdom of Thailand, is a Southeast Asian nation located at the heart of the Indochinese Peninsula. Covering 513,120 square kilometers (198,120 sq mi), it is home to over 71.7 million people. Thailand shares borders with Myanmar and Laos to the north, Laos and Cambodia to the east, the Gulf of Thailand and Malaysia to the south, and the Andaman Sea and Myanmar’s southern tip to the west. Additionally, it has maritime borders with Vietnam in the southeast (Gulf of Thailand) and with Indonesia and India to the southwest (Andaman Sea). The country's capital and largest city is Bangkok. Although Thailand is a constitutional monarchy and parliamentary democracy in name, its recent political history has seen several coups and periods of military rule.
Personal Documents
- Current passport (minimum validity for 06 months until the planned date of return and minimum two blank pages for visa stamp) with all old passports.
- Two recent color photograph (4.0 cm x 6.0 cm) with white background but no cap and no sun glasses. Please note: photo should not more than 03 months old and should not be used in any of the previous visas. Applicant’s ear must be visible in his/her photo.
- Birth certificate copy of children (if travel with family)
- Marriage certificate or divorce certificate copy (as per religion). Death certificate copy requires for widows. Please note: If applicant apply with family but his/ her name is not mentioned in the spouse’s passport or vice versa then marriage certificate copy is mandatory.
Professional Documents
- For Business Person: Trade license (renewal), business card and a forwarding letter in the company’s letterhead Pad require for Proprietorship, Partnership and limited company.
- Additional documents for Partnership: Business agreement/deed copy.
- Additional documents for Limited company: Memorandum of article, certificate of incorporation, form XII, VAT, IRC and Membership certificate (If any).
- For Employee : No objection certificate (NOC) , Pay Slip / Salary Statement, GO and note verbal (for official passport holders)
- For Student: Student ID copy, school leave letter / Academic calendar.
Financial Documents
- Only original Bank Statement and Bank Solvency Letter are acceptable. Sufficient funds (BDT 60,000 for individual and BDT 1, 20,000 for family) should be available in the bank till the processed passport is returned. Loan, FDR account and DPS accounts will NOT be accepted. In case of foreign bank statement, solvency certificate is not mandatory
Overseas Documents
- For foreign passports, work document from local office in Bangladesh is required (if applicable). If do not have local bank account in Bangladesh, applicant must submit the Letter of Salary Guarantee issued by Bangladeshi company;
- The first applicant can sponsor father, mother, children, father-in-law and mother-in-law. Copies of documents of the first applicant including a Sponsorship Letter, Bank Statement, Bank Solvency Certificate, Marriage Certificate and/or Proof of Relationship Certificate are required; A certified copy of an identification of applicant’s sponsor if the applicant submits a sponsor’s Bank Statement and the sponsor is not submitting an application together with the applicant;
